Kafka很多时候的消息输出都是Pb格式的,不方便查看,但是通过以下的手法可以转化成json格式进行查看;
1.Mac安装Protobuf
2.下载main.py+image.bin【2个文件】
main.py
1.python打开并进行main.py;
2.运行成功界面如下:
image.bin
3.把这个image.bin放在你自己电脑的这个目录下;
4.打开终端
(1)复制1条pb消息;⚠️不需要粘贴这条消息⚠️
(2)执行: pbpaste | base64 -d | protoc --descriptor_set_in=/Users/XXX/image.bin --decode=models.tradingdto.TradingResultDTO
⚠️/Users/XXX/image.bin需要换成你的电脑路径⚠️
(3)这样就可以解析出json格式内容拉;